enchytrae

/ɛnˈkɪtrē/

Definitions

1. noun

A type of small, soil-dwelling worm, specifically a species of clitellate annelid, particularly in the genus Enchytraeus.

“The biologist studied the behavior of enchytrae in the forest ecosystem.”
